What Is a License Key for Reaper?

At its core, a license key for Reaper is a unique code that activates the full version of the

software. Reaper offers a generous evaluation period, allowing users to test the DAW

without restrictions for up to 60 days. After this trial, purchasing a license key legitimizes

your copy and supports the ongoing development of this impressive tool.

Unlike some other DAWs that come with hefty price tags, Reaper’s licensing model is

straightforward and user-friendly. There are two main types of licenses: a discounted

“discounted license” for personal, educational, and small business use, and a “commercial

license” for larger businesses and enterprises. Both licenses provide the same

functionality; the difference lies mostly in pricing and intended usage.

Entering and Managing Your License Key in Reaper

Once you’ve purchased your license key for Reaper, activating it is straightforward but

crucial for uninterrupted workflow. Here’s how you do it:

Open Reaper and go to the “Help” menu.

1.

Select “About REAPER.”

2.

Click the “License” button.

3.

Paste your license key into the provided field.

4.

Confirm and restart the DAW if necessary.

5.

Keeping your license key saved securely is important because you might need it if you

reinstall the software or move to a new computer. Reaper allows license transfers, so if

you upgrade your setup, your license remains valid.

Common Questions About License Keys

Many users wonder if the license key is tied to a specific device or if it can be shared.

Reaper’s license is flexible: it is intended for a single user and can be installed on multiple

machines, provided it’s used by the same person. This flexibility is ideal for producers

working in different locations or on multiple computers.

Another common question is about updates. The license key for Reaper covers all updates

within the current major version and beyond, so you don’t have to worry about paying

again when new features are released.

Reaper Licensing Tiers and Pricing

Reaper offers two primary license types:

Discounted License: Priced at $60, this license is intended for personal use,

1.

educational purposes, and small businesses generating less than $20,000 in annual

gross revenue.

Commercial License: At $225, this license is required for larger businesses or

2.

users whose income exceeds the threshold mentioned above.

Both licenses provide the same core features, including unlimited track counts, plugin

support, comprehensive routing, and customization options. The main difference lies in

the user’s eligibility and the legal right to use the software in commercial contexts.

Comparison with Other DAWs’ Licensing Models

Comparing Reaper’s license key approach to other popular DAWs highlights its unique

selling points:

Ableton Live: Requires purchasing different editions (Intro, Standard, Suite) with

1.

varying features and content, often at higher prices and with limited upgrade

policies.

FL Studio: Offers lifetime free updates with a one-time purchase but at a higher

2.

entry cost compared to Reaper.

Pro Tools: Predominantly subscription-based, leading to ongoing costs and

3.

dependence on active payments.

In contrast, Reaper’s simple licensing model offers excellent value, especially for users

who want a full-featured DAW without subscription commitments or tiered restrictions.

How to Obtain and Activate Your License Key for Reaper

Purchasing a license key for Reaper is straightforward. Users can visit the official Cockos

website, select the appropriate license type, and complete a secure payment. Upon

purchase, the license key is delivered electronically, typically via email.

To activate Reaper, users simply enter the license key in the software’s licensing dialog.

This process unlocks the full version and removes the nag screen that appears during the

evaluation period. The license information is stored locally, allowing Reaper to operate

offline without requiring continuous internet checks.
